The size of Culburra Beach is approximately 13.6 square kilometres. There are 6 parks, covering nearly 0.8% of the total area. The population of Culburra Beach in 2016 was 2874 people. By 2021 the population was 2946 showing a population growth of 2.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Culburra Beach is 60-69 years. Households in Culburra Beach are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Culburra Beach work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 70.00% of the homes in Culburra Beach were owner-occupied compared with 70.50% in 2016.
